This non-technical course is designed to help students access their creativity and expression with a view to developing a portfolio for entry into the full-time Jewellery Art and Design program*. Introductions to drawing, design, 3D forms, and understanding contemporary art with be covered. Classes will include hands-on exercises, visual presentations, group discussions, and a field trip to the Vancouver Art Gallery. Approximately 2 hours per week of take home projects will be required. Extra materials: $20. *Please note that participation in this course does not guarantee entry into the Jewellery Art and Design program.
